Following are the Geographical factors impacted the development of early river valley civilizations:
Ample water resources help them to feed, bath, wash and to do so many domestication works.
River valley means fertile plains, which is so good for agriculture as they can grow lots of different varieties of crops. They didn't have to be depend upon rain.
It helped in transportation, which were used for trading and movement from one place to another.
It protects them from enemy as at a time so many person can't attack over the residing civilization.
